How To Fix /SAPAPO/PE089 - Error when writing application log for service &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/PE -

  • Message number: 089

  • Message text: Error when writing application log for service &1

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/PE089 typically indicates an issue related to the application log when working with S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O). This error occurs when the system encounters a problem while trying to write an application log for a specific service.

    Cause:

    The error can be caused by several factors, including:

    1.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to write to the application log.
    2. Database Issues: There may be problems with the database, such as connectivity issues or database locks.
    3.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the APO system or related components.
    4. System Performance: High system load or performance issues may prevent the log from being written.
    5. Log Table Issues: The application log tables may be full or corrupted.

    Solution:

    To resolve the /SAPAPO/PE089 error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to write to the application log. You can check this in transaction SU53 after the error occurs.

    2. Review System Logs: Use transaction SM21 to check the system log for any related errors or warnings that might provide more context about the issue.

    3. Database Health Check: Verify the health of the database. Check for any locks or performance issues that might be affecting the ability to write logs.

    4. Clear Application Logs: If the application log tables are full, you may need to clear old logs. You can do this using transaction SLG1 to view logs and SLG2 to delete them.

    5.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ings in the APO system to ensure everything is set up correctly.

    6. System Performance: Monitor system performance and check for any bottlenecks that might be affecting the writing of logs.

    7. Consult S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this specific error. There may be patches or updates available that resolve known issues.

    8.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ists after trying the above steps, consider reaching out to SAP Support for further assistance.
